On August 4, 2020, a massive explosion rocked Beirut, Lebanon, leaving a trail of destruction and sorrow that echoed far beyond its borders. As Americans, we often find ourselves grappling with the profound impact of such events, questioning our role in a world where tragedies can feel both distant and shockingly close. Let’s unpack the emotions stirred by this event and explore how it has reshaped our global perspective.

1. The Immediate Shock and Outpouring of Support

The initial shock was palpable, as images and videos of the explosion spread across social media like wildfire 🔥. The sheer scale of the devastation, captured in real-time, brought the tragedy into living rooms around the globe. In the United States, the immediate reaction was one of horror followed swiftly by an outpouring of support. Social media platforms were flooded with messages of solidarity, fundraising campaigns, and heartfelt condolences. This collective response highlighted the power of human connection in times of crisis.
